随着办公软件的普及,数据处理效率成为职场核心竞争力。excel 自动排序编号公式作为一种强大的数据处理工具,能显著提升信息分类与管理的效率。通过对公式原理、应用场景及实操技巧的深度解析,帮助用户掌握高效编号与排序技术。
理解 excel 自动排序编号公式,需要结合其逻辑核心与操作环境进行综合把握。这类公式不仅仅是简单的按键操作,而是基于条件判断、相对引用和数组逻辑的复杂组合。从原理层面看,它依赖于工作表单元格的地址引用(如 B1:A1000)与公式中的判断条件(如 IF 函数或 VBA 代码执行),通过层层嵌套实现数据的自动化处理。在性能层面,虽然部分老旧公式可能面临计算慢的问题,但现代版本的优化方案已大幅改善。在行业实践中,从基础编号到深度分类,从单一列表到多维报表,公式的应用无处不在。极创号凭借十余年的实战经验,将晦涩的公式语言转化为直观的代码逻辑,让普通用户也能轻松应对复杂数据场景。
入门级:基础编号与简单排序概览
对于新接触数据处理的用户,理解基础编号与简单排序公式是入门的必经之路。这类公式主要解决将数据按数值或文本进行初筛和连续编号的问题,适合日常报表整理。
以文本编号为例,假设要按 A1:A1000 区域中的文本依次编号 1 到 1000。基础公式通常结合 IF 函数与 COUNTA 功能实现。例如:=IF(COUNTA(A1:A1000)=0,"",1)&(COUNTA(A1:A1000)>0) 逻辑看似简单,实则包含条件填充与计数判断的双重操作。极创号专家会强调,正确设置行列范围至关重要,若范围包含空值,公式可能产生误判。在实操中,应先选中目标区域,再输入公式,最后按 Enter 键执行。
对于数字排序,逻辑更为直接。若需将数字 1-1000 按升序排列,可结合 IF 函数进行分组判断。例如:=IF(A1=1,"1",IF(A1=2,"2",...))。这种一对多的公式写法要求用户清晰规划公式行数,避免公式过长导致公式引用混乱。极创号通过拆解步骤,教会用户如何从固定格式转换为动态编号。
进阶级:数据清洗与条件逻辑处理
随着数据复杂度的提升,基础编号已无法满足需求,需要引入条件逻辑处理。极创号特别强调,条件判断是公式的灵魂所在。通过 IF 函数嵌套,可以实现多维度筛选与标记。
假设需要对 A 列进行分组,B 列为类别标签,C 列为描述性文本。公式结构应包含 IF 函数判断主类别,配合嵌套 IF 判断次类别,最后通过 LEN 函数统计字数。例如:=IF(A2="销售",IF(B2="华东",C2&" - 华东区"),IF(B2="华北",C2&" - 华北区"),C2) 这种结构能清晰展示分类层级。
在数据清洗过程中,极创号还会讲解如何处理空值与重复项。公式中常结合 CLEAN 函数去除非数字字符,或结合专门的 VBA 代码块批量清洗。针对批量处理,极创号建议用户先在 Excel 中建立模板,通过公式填充后,利用 Ctrl+Enter 或宏功能快速应用。
高阶技巧:批量公式与动态更新机制
面对海量数据,个人操作效率低下,此时动态公式与批量公式成为关键。极创号主张利用绝对引用与相对引用的配合,实现公式的动态调整与批量处理。
动态公式的核心在于利用 ROW 和 COLUMN 函数。例如:=IF(A2=10,A2&" - 第 10 号",IF(A2=20,A2&" - 第 20 号",IF(A2=30,A2&" - 第 30 号",IF(A2=40,A2&" - 第 40 号",IF(A2=50,A2&" - 第 50 号",IF(A2=60,A2&" - 第 60 号",IF(A2=70,A2&" - 第 70 号",IF(A2=80,A2&" - 第 80 号",IF(A2=90,A2&" - 第 90 号",IF(A2=100,A2&" - 第 100 号",101)))))))。这种多重嵌套结构虽繁琐,但能自动适应新数据行,无需手动复制粘贴公式。
在动态更新方面,极创号提醒用户注意列宽调整对公式的影响。当工作表列宽变化时,相对引用会自动变化,导致公式失效。
也是因为这些,使用绝对引用(如 $A$2)来锁定单元格地址,配合动态公式,是实现公式自动适应数据变化的最佳方案。
实战案例:企业数据归档与多维分析
为了验证理论,极创号分享了一个典型的企业数据归档案例。某公司需将 2000 条员工记录按部门、工龄、薪资水平进行综合编号归档。
场景设定:A 列为部门,B 列为工龄,C 列为薪资。目标是在 D 列生成唯一的归档编号 E1:E2000。
公式逻辑如下:
1.首先判断是否为空,保证只处理有效数据:=IF(COUNTA(A1:A2000)=0,"",1)&(COUNTA(A1:A2000)>0)
2.在此基础上,结合部门与工龄进行判断,生成前缀:=IF(A2="后勤",IF(B2>=5,"后勤 - 资深"),IF(A2="技术",IF(B2>=5,"技术 - 资深",IF(B2>=2,"技术 - 中级",IF(B2>=1,"技术 - 初级",1))))
3.最后结合薪资作为唯一标识符,确保即使部门相同、工龄相同,若薪资不同则编号不同。例如:=D2&" &"&C2&" - " &"&C2。
此案例展示了极创号公式的灵活性与强大逻辑处理能力。用户只需遵循上述步骤,即可快速生成唯一编号。在实际应用中,还需注意公式的稳定性,避免因公式过长导致计算机运行缓慢,此时可适当拆分公式或使用 VBA 宏辅助处理。
进阶应用:大数据集下的性能优化与共享
在处理百万级数据时,公式的性能是关键瓶颈。极创号在此处分享专业优化技巧,包括公式拆分、列宽预留及版本控制。
公式拆分是将复杂逻辑拆分为多个短句,分别计算后再求值,以提高计算速度。例如将多个 IF 函数合并为一个长公式,降低单次计算压力。
列宽预留是指在生成公式前,根据预计数据量合理设置列宽,避免 Excel 自动调整布局后引用混乱。
在共享方面,极创号建议用户在保存文件时,将公式指定为“公式专用”,并建议用户定期备份公式部分,防止误操作丢失。对于移动办公,需确保公式逻辑在断开连接后依然有效(如使用相对路径)。
极创号还特别指出,公式维护的重要性。公式结构一旦固定,修改难度极大。建议用户建立公式模板库,对新产生的公式进行归档与版本管理,便于团队协作与后续迭代。
归结起来说:极创号为您打造高效数据管理生态
,excel 自动排序编号公式是提升职场效率的利器。它不仅是数学逻辑的体现,更是工程艺术的结晶。从入门的基础编号到进级的条件逻辑,再到高阶的动态更新与性能优化,极创号十余年的经验证明,只要掌握了正确的公式结构与操作技巧,即可轻松驾驭 Excel 强大的数据处理能力。
在极创号的指导下,用户可以构建属于自己的数据管理生态,让每一份数据都井然有序。无论是日常报销、项目归档还是企业决策支持,极创号提供的公式方案都能提供专业支撑。极创号专注 excel 自动排序编号公式十年,是 excel 自动排序编号公式行业的专家。通过本文的深度解析,希望每位用户都能掌握高效编号与排序技术,让 Excel 成为个人办公的最佳伙伴。
希望这篇文章能帮助您掌握 excel 自动排序编号公式的精髓,让我们共同开启高效数据处理的新篇章。